Transaction 52fb377638af91e9bf39da3e29cc66c46399a8831e7c6039d80e1c814a1ddcf0
1 Input
1 Output
-
52fb377638af91e9bf39da3e29cc66c46399a8831e7c6039d80e1c814a1ddcf0:0
- value
- 131312804
- script pubkey
- OP_0 OP_PUSHBYTES_20 665566deb350cc2171ec81adcf6dd40ce3e36bfe
- address
- bc1qve2kdh4n2rxzzu0vsxku7mw5pn37x6l7jx4y5e